FuelCell Energy, Inc. (Nasdaq: FCEL), a global leader in
delivering clean, innovative and affordable fuel cell solutions for
the supply, recovery and storage of energy, today announced the
signing of an exclusive option agreement with the County of Orange
regarding the utilization of landfill gas at the Coyote Canyon
landfill in Newport Beach, California for a fuel cell
project. The option agreement, won via a competitive
solicitation, provides FuelCell Energy an exclusive right to
develop the landfill gas as a source of renewable biofuel, expected
to culminate in the negotiation and execution of a Landfill Gas
Delivery and Site License Agreement.
FuelCell Energy expects to install operating fuel cell systems
that will produce both renewable electricity and renewable
hydrogen. With targeted output of between 1,200 to 2,400 kilograms
per day of hydrogen, this plant will supply renewable hydrogen to
the largest fuel cell vehicle market, Los Angeles, in late
2020.
“We are pleased to have been selected by Orange County Waste
& Recycling to develop and deliver this 100% renewable source
of hydrogen and electricity,” said Chip Bottone, President and
Chief Executive Officer of FuelCell Energy, Inc. “This site
is an important element of our overall strategy to provide
renewable power and hydrogen to support California’s efforts to
decarbonize its transportation sector. FuelCell Energy has
developed a technology that not only provides utility scale
solutions for reliable distributed power, but a solution to cost
effectively deliver hydrogen to markets that are rapidly adapting
hydrogen powered vehicles. This will be our second project of this
type in southern California, adding to our previously announced
project with Toyota at the Port of Long Beach. The opportunity is
substantial for cost effective distributed hydrogen solutions, and
we are just in the early stages of broad deployment of our
carbonate fuel cell solution.”
